Eleven MIAA Wrestlers Garner All-Academic Honors from NWCA

Manheim, Pa. – On Thursday (March 14), the NWCA announced the full slate of 2018-19 Academic Team and Individual honorees for NCAA Division III with awards going to 261 individuals representing 83 institutions.

Of the individuals honored, 11 wrestlers from three MIAA wrestling programs garnered accolades for their academic and athletic success in 2018-19. Olivet led the way with seven honorees, while Alma and Trine each had two.

The individual honorees included All-MIAA wrestlers Reese Wallis (133), Zach Cooper (149), and MIAA Most Valuable Wrestler Tyler Grimsley (165 lbs).
